If you run the setup.exe for version 8.5.1 on a Windows 10 or 11 machine, you might encounter an error like: "Microsoft Visual C++ Runtime Library Runtime Error" or "Error 1335. The cabinet file 'nilvrte850.cab' required for this installation is corrupt" . These errors occur because the legacy installer conflicts with modern C++ Redistributable packages or Windows security features. We will address fixes for this in Part 4.
